BeadFuse is a free online bead pattern generator for perler, Hama, and fuse bead crafters. Upload a photo — a pet, a game sprite, a drawing — and it becomes a grid chart where every square is a real bead color you can buy. Unlike generic photo-to-pixel tools, BeadFuse matches colors against measured bead palettes (Perler 103 + Hama 92), counts every bead so you know exactly what to buy, and exports printable board-by-board PDF charts. It also ships a free library of 120+ downloadable patterns, a grid editor, and an AI generator that turns a text idea into a bead-ready pattern. Conversion runs entirely in your browser — photos never leave your device.
